TATTENAI (Aram. תַּתְּנַי; I Esd. 6:3, 7, 26, Sisinnes), governor ( peḥah) of the territory known as "Beyond The River" ( eber nahara in Aramaic; Coele-Syria and Phoenicia in I Esd.) under Darius I. Tattenai was subordinate, at least at first, to Ushtannu (Hystanes), governor of Babylon and "Beyond The River." Tattenai. (Tatʹte·nai). The governor of the Persian province “beyond the River” during the reign of Darius I (Hystaspis). When the Jews again started to rebuild the temple in Darius’ second year (520 B.C.E.), Tattenai and his colleagues came to Jerusalem to conduct an inquiry. TATTENAI. tat'-e-ni (tattenay, various forms in the Septuagint; the King James Version Tatnai, tat'ni, tat'na-i'): A Persian governor, who was the successor of Rehum in Samaria and some other provinces belonging to Judah, bordering on Samaria. TATTENAItăt’ ə nī ( ֠תַּתְּנַי ). KJV TATNAI, tăt’ nī. A Pers. governor W of the River Euphrates during the reign of Darius Hystaspis ( Ezra 5:3, 6; 6:6, 13 ). In 1 Esdras 6:3, 7, 27 and 7:1, he is called Sisinnes. He reported to the Pers. government on the complaints made regarding the rebuilding of the Temple.
